بوتاسترپ چیست ؟
آموزش بوت استرپ ارومیه
تا به حال به این موضوع فکر کردهاید که ایجاد یک رابط کاربری ساده از ابتدای کار و تنها با استفاده از HTML/CSS چقدر زمانبر خواهد بود؟ خب اگر جواب این سوال را به صورت صریح میخواهید باید بگویم که زمان بسیار زیادی را برای انجام چنین کاری لازم دارید. فرض کنید قصد ایجاد یک اپلیکیشن را دارید و تنها چند ساعت وقت برای تحویل یک رابط کاربری ساده را هم دارید در اینصورت چه کاری انجام میدهید؟ ممکن است بگویید که از یک قالب آماده استفاده میکنم، خب این هم روشی است اما استفاده از قالب آماده برای پروژهها بنظر کار درستی نیست. در چنین مواقعی شما به یک فریمورک یا کتابخانه نیاز خواهید داشت، فریمورکی که شامل المانها و کامپوننتهای آماده متفاوتی باشد که به شما این قابلیت را بدهد تا بتوانید بصورت سریع تمام موارد گفته شده را در کنار یکدیگر قرار داده و در نهایت رابط کاربری را ارائه دهید. خب Bootstrap در حقیقت یکی از این کتابخانههاست.
برای آن دست از دوستانی که هیچ آشنایی با بوتاسترپ (Bootstrap) ندارند باید گفت که بوتاسترپ یک فریمورک CSS به حساب میآید که با استفاده از آن میتوانید استایلهای مورد نظر خود در طراحی وب را سادهتر پیاده سازی کنید. این فریمورک توسط توییتر معرفی شده و در حال حاضر بسیاری از شرکتهای بزرگ دنیا برای توسعه رابط کاربریشان از این ابزار استفاده میکنند.
در طول دوره آموزش بوتاسترپ ما سعی میکنیم شما را با تمام بخشهای این فریمورک کاربردی آشنا کنیم تا فرایند طراحی وب با استفاده از بوتاسترپ برای شما سادهتر شود.
چرا به یادگیری بوتاسترپ نیاز داریم؟
سوال مهمی که قبل از شروع کار با بوتاسترپ شاید برایتان پیش بیاید این است که اصلا چه نیازی به بوتاسترپ است؟ نمیشود بدون استفاده از آن وبسایت مورد نظر خود را طراحی کرد.
مسئله مهم در استفاده از بوتاسترپ افزایش سرعت عمل پیادهسازی بخشهای مختلف یک وبسایت است، برای مثال ما در راکت برای پیادهسازی بخش پنل مدیریت وبسایت نیاز به سرعت عمل و کمتر درگیر شدن در قسمت Frontend این پنل داشتیم، در اینجا بهترین انتخاب از نظر ما بوتاسترپ بود که با استفاده از آن میتوانستیم پنل مدیریتی با ظاهر مناسب و رسپانسیو ایجاد کنیم.
از این جهت در مواقعی استفاده از یک فریمورک کاربردی CSS مانند بوتاسترپ میتواند یک انتخاب عاقلانه و درست باشد.
بوتاسترپ محبوبترین فریمورک CSS
اگر قبل از آموزش بوتاسترپ تنها با استفاده از HTML و CSS یک وبسایت طراحی کرده باشید قطعا با چالشهای متفاوت CSS در طراحی وب آشنا هستید و میدانید برای پیادهسازی هر بخش به چه میزان میتواند شما را در گیر خودش کند.
اگر قبل از آموزش بوتاسترپ تنها با استفاده از HTML و CSS یک وبسایت طراحی کرده باشید قطعا با چالشهای متفاوت CSS در طراحی وب آشنا هستید و میدانید برای پیادهسازی هر بخش به چه میزان میتواند شما را در گیر خودش کند.
- داشتن سیستم Grid قدرتمند
- قابلیت شخصی سازی بسیار بالا
- ایجاد راحت یک سایت رسپانسیو
- المنتهای با استایلهای آماده برای استفاده در وبسایت
- افزایش سرعت تکمیل وبسایت نسبت به طراحی با استفاده از CSS
- قالبهای رایگان و آمادهای زیادی که با استفاده از بوتاسترپ پیاده شدهاند.
البته در کنار این فواید گاهی شما را دچار محدودیت هم خواهد کرد برای مثال در استفاده از CSS شما قدرت عمل بسیار بیشتری خواهید داشت. اما باید گفت بوتاسترپ چیزی متفاوتی نسبت به CSS نیست و شما میتوانید به شکل کامل آن را شخصیسازی کنید. در طول دوره آموزش بوتاسترپ ما سعی میکنیم از این فواید و ویژگیها برای شما بیشتر بگوییم.
پیشنیازهای شما برای یادگیری بوت استرپ
بوتاسترپ چیزی نیست جز قطعه کدهای آماده نوشته شده با استفاده از HTML/CSS/JS، بنابراین اگر نیاز دارید که به خوبی با بوتاسترپ آشنایی پیدا کنید ابتدای کار دورههای آموزشی HTML، CSS و در نهایت Javascript که البته برای گذراندن این دوره یادگیری جاوااسکریپت چندان الزامی نخواهد بود اما اگر قصد پیشرفت کردن را دارید بهتر است آن را نیز یاد بگیرید.
سرفصلهای این دوره به چه شکل است؟
ما در این دوره سعی می کنیم شما را به صورت تمام و کمال با ویژگیها و امکانات بوت استرپ آشنا کنیم. همچنین برای کامل کردن این موضوع ما ۲ پروژه عملی را به صورت کامل با استفاده از بوت استرپ پیادهسازی میکنیم.
- نصب و پیاده سازی بوت استرپ
- پیاده سازی پروژه های مختلف
- بررسی ویژگیهای مختلف بوت استرپ
- کار با ویژگیهای لایه بندی بوت استرپ
- استفاده از کامپوننتهای مختلف در بوت استرپ
- و.........